Kids' Activities
Engaging children in fun and educational activities is a great way to keep them entertained while also fostering their development. Here are some exciting ideas for kids' activities:
1. DIY Science Experiments
Encourage curiosity by conducting simple science experiments at home. From making a volcano with baking soda and vinegar to creating a homemade lava lamp, these experiments are both entertaining and educational.
2. Nature Scavenger Hunt
Take the little ones outdoors for a nature scavenger hunt. Create a list of items for them to find, such as a pinecone, a red leaf, or a feather. This activity not only keeps them active but also teaches them about the environment.
3. Arts and Crafts
Unleash their creativity with arts and crafts projects. Whether it's painting, making paper crafts, or creating homemade jewelry, arts and crafts are a fantastic way for kids to express themselves while developing fine motor skills.
Educational Upcycling
Teaching children about the importance of sustainability and upcycling can be both educational and fun. Upcycling involves repurposing old or discarded items to create something new and useful. Here are some ideas for educational upcycling projects:
1. Tin Can Planters
Turn empty tin cans into cute planters by painting them with vibrant colors and planting small herbs or flowers. This project teaches kids about recycling and caring for plants.
2. Cardboard Box Creations
Transform cardboard boxes into imaginative play structures like a spaceship, a castle, or a dollhouse. Encourage kids to decorate and customize their creations, fostering their creativity and resourcefulness.
3. Plastic Bottle Bird Feeder
Repurpose plastic bottles into bird feeders by cutting holes for birds to access the seeds. Hang these feeders in your backyard and observe different bird species visiting. This activity not only promotes recycling but also teaches kids about wildlife.
